  • Rotating and unsprung masses – wheel weight

    Here are the masses of the complete wheels that can be mounted on the Omega. I would like to know how much mass you have to accelerate – especially the 18″ wide tyre fraction. Winter tyres on steel rim 205/65 R15 to 6.5 J x 15 ET 33 with a Goodyear Ultra Grip 8 weighs 18.5 kg summer tyres on the Intra rim from the Design Edition equipment 235/45 R17 to 7.5 J x 17 ET39 with a Goodyear Eagle F1 Asymmetric 2 weighs 22.0 kg

  • Omega B – X20XEV – Cause of the FC shower ->P0335, P0340, P0351, P0352?

    Hello, after my workshop doesn’t really know what to do, I try this round-around hit. The workshop has read out the following codes from my Omega B Caravan (X20XEV): – P0340 ( 8 ) = camshaft sensor defective – P0351 ( 1 ) = ignition coil A voltage too low – P0351 ( 2 ) = ignition coil A voltage too high – P0352 ( 1 ) = ignition coil B voltage too low – P0352 ( 2 ) = ignition coil B voltage too high – P0335 ( 8 ) = crankshaft sensor defective So, what happens: – for a few weeks the control light ‘motor electronics’ is going on again and again during the ride – sometimes the engine has no more power – off / switched on then eliminates the fault – after 2 times “deleting error memory” were again in the next occurrence of the fault – assumption is that the codes are all triggered at the same time What can be the cause?
